Съдържание[Крия][Покажи]
Ако сте част от общностите за кодиране, обработка на изображения или графичен дизайн, вероятно сте се натъкнали на факта, че съществуват редица използвани формати на файлове с изображения. Това е така, защото всеки файлов формат има свой собствен набор от функции и приложения, които затрудняват общностите да изберат универсален файлов формат или дори да премахнат следващите формати.
Винаги е имало разгорещен дебат между членовете на общността относно това кой файлов формат е най-добрият за използване и за какви цели. Два от файловите формати, често повдигани в тези дебати, са този на HEIC и WebP.
В тази статия ще сравним основните характеристики, плюсовете и минусите на двата формата на графични файлове.
HEIC
Високоефективният контейнер за изображения (HEIC) е формат на изображения, създаден от Moving Picture Experts Group (MPEG) през 2015 г. и оттогава е приет от Apple като стандарт за запазване на файлове с изображения в iPhone устройства.
Този файлов формат е моделиран след високоефективния формат на файла с изображения (HEIF) и обхваща мултимедийни файлове, като например текст, аудио и видео. Този файлов формат е създаден като средство за запазване на вашите изображения по начин, който да заема по-малко място в паметта, като същевременно запазва високо качество.
Основни функции
- Позволява съхраняване на отделни и поредици от изображения.
- Използва високоефективен видео контейнер (HEVC) за кодиране на изображения.
- Използва техники за компресиране и алгоритми за кодиране на изображения.
- Може да съхранява елементи от изображения, производни, последователности и метаданни.
Предимства
- Спестява място със съхраняване на изображения и поредици от изображения в по-малки размери на файлове.
- Усъвършенстваният алгоритъм за компресия осигурява до 50% по-малък размер на изображението, като същевременно запазва качеството на изображението.
- Използва 16-битова тонална гама, която осигурява жива цветова палитра.
- Поддържа се от Apple iOS 11 и по-нова версия, Mac OS и Android на Google.
- Съвместим с повечето софтуери за редактиране (напр. Adobe Photoshop).
Недостатъци
- Не е съвместим с по-стари версии на много операционни системи (т.е. Windows 8.1 и по-долу).
- От март 2021 г. нито един уеб браузър не поддържа HEIC изначално.
WebP
Форматът за уеб изображения (WebP) е модерен формат на файл с изображения, разработен от Google през 2010 г. WebP използва мощни алгоритми за компресия, за да изразходва по-малко място в паметта, като същевременно запазва качеството на картината. Използвайки този файлов формат, уеб администраторите и уеб разработчиците могат да създават по-малки, по-богати изображения, които правят мрежата по-бърза. WebP наскоро придоби по-голяма популярност, тъй като беше пуснат като с отворен код файлов формат.
Основни функции
- Използва както алгоритми със загуба (компресия със загуба на данни), така и без загуба (компресия без загуба на данни).
- Поддържа анимация и алфа прозрачност.
- WebP изображенията съхраняват метаданни за неговата информация за прозрачност на база пиксел.
- Изображението може да има няколко кадъра с паузи между тях, което го прави анимация.
Предимства
- Включва 24-битов RGB цвят с прозрачност в сравнение с обичайното 8-битово цветно кодиране.
- Анимациите могат да комбинират кадри със загуби и без загуби, за да произведат оптимално качество на изображението.
- Заемайте много по-малко място в сравнение с други анимации, поддържащи графични формати, до 64% по-малко!
- Страниците с WebP изображения се зареждат по-бързо поради по-малкия им размер.
Недостатъци
- По-интензивен процесор в сравнение с други анимации, поддържащи графични файлови формати.
- Липсва поддръжка в сравнение с друга анимация, поддържаща графични формати, като GIF.
- Добавянето на поддръжка на WebP към браузърите увеличава отпечатъка на кода и повърхността на атака.
- Компресираните WebP изображения с загуби имат намалено качество поради използваната техника на компресиране.
Заключение
Както можете да видите, има значителни плюсове и минуси за използването на HEIC и WebP в зависимост от това какво искате да постигнете. Ако искате да използвате изображения с качество JPEG, но с по-малък размер, тогава имате HEIC, ако искате да използвате анимации с по-добро качество от това на GIF файловете, които заемат по-малко място, тогава WebP е форматът на изображението за вас!
Надявам се ръководството да е обширно и да ви даде правилна представа за двата формата на изображения, техните ключови характеристики и тяхното използване. Кой формат предпочитате и защо? Кажете ни в секцията за коментари, споделете и тази статия, за да помогнете на приятелите си да решат кой формат на файла с изображения да използват в следващия си голям проект.
Густаво Балмаседа
с webp получавате и изображения с jpg качество с по-малък размер. всичко зависи от степента на компресиране в крайна сметка jpg също е формат със загуби. webp на 90% няма разлика с jpg 95 и размера е горе-долу наполовина (на диск). единственото нещо, което webp пропуска е, че най-големият размер не може да бъде по-голям от 16300px или така.